Martin Brundle 'Bored' by Max Verstappen's Constant F1 Criticism: "Either Go or Stop Talking About It"

Summary by Sportskeeda
Max Verstappen has spent much of the 2026 season voicing frustration over the current regulations and the nature of racing, while also hinting at a possible exit.

Max Verstappen is far from happy with the new technical regulations introduced this year in Formula 1, to say the least. And the Dutch driver, currently ninth in the championship, has been constantly hinting since pre-season testing that he might leave F1 because he no longer enjoys driving, despite being under contract with Red Bull until the end of 2028. These comments are starting to irritate some people, including Martin Brundle, the former …

Max Verstappen is not a fan of the new Formula 1. The four-time world champion will not tire of stressing how little fun driving in the new cars makes him. Ex-pilot Martin Brundle is getting tired of it and can no longer hear the whining of the Dutchman.
